Output 3ae58589ebfc2f508c25a32033def35e5e180f23d008331318912156f87bc4e5:3

value
48175433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3133b5a72f48c83196a8f9b0a08fa13907e7b21 OP_EQUAL
address
3KUUjCj45tEA1E3jxtjhPBjiwDY5oPbY5K
transaction
3ae58589ebfc2f508c25a32033def35e5e180f23d008331318912156f87bc4e5
spent
true